Caesars Entertainment is a renowned leader in the hospitality and gaming industry, known for its commitment to providing extraordinary experiences to guests across its multiple properties. The company operates a diverse portfolio including Harrah's Council Bluffs, Horseshoe Council Bluffs, the Mid-America Center, and the Hilton Garden Inn, all of which serve the Council Bluffs metro area. These properties offer a wide range of amenities from top-tier gaming experiences at two casinos to comfortable accommodations at two hotels along with expansive convention, meeting, and entertainment spaces suitable for various events. Job Duties
- Greets customers at Valet Porte-Cochere and assists with luggage transportation
- parks and retrieves customer vehicles ensuring safety and efficiency
- initiates and engages in guest conversations regarding property services including restaurants, entertainment, and events
- accurately completes luggage tags and valet tickets including vehicle damage inspections
- answers valet phone and responds to luggage room calls and expedited car retrieval requests for VIP guests
- practices lateral service by assisting in other roles such as driving shuttles when needed
- complies with company policies, procedures, and industry regulations while upholding department goals
- maintains a professional appearance and encourages positive workplace behavior
- performs other related duties as assigned
